ORAFOL and Avery Dennison Confirmed as Gold Sponsors for National Sign & Graphics Awards

ORAFOL and Avery Dennison Confirmed as Gold Sponsors for National Sign & Graphics Awards

Avery Dennison and ORAFOL Australia have confirmed Gold Sponsorships for the 2026 ASGA National Sign & Graphics Awards, continuing their longstanding involvement with the awards program.

Hosted by ASGA, the National Sign & Graphics Awards are the premier event on the sign and graphics calendar, serving as both a recognition of achievement and a showcase of the best work the industry has produced over the past two years.

ASGA President Mick Harrold thanked the companies, noting that the early confirmations reflected suppliers' ongoing commitment to supporting the sector.

“ORAFOL and Avery Dennison have been strong supporters of our Awards in the past, and it’s great to have them back on board as the first confirmed sponsors for our 10th biennial Awards,” he said.
“Events like this simply could not happen without the backing of leading industry suppliers, and we are grateful and excited to have their support for this milestone event.”

Entries for the Awards will open on Monday, 9 February, following a call issued last week encouraging industry businesses to begin preparing their submissions ahead of the official competition launch.

Harrold said that while the 2026 Organising Committee has yet to confirm the categories formally, there would be broad representation across the industry.“Whatever part of our sector you operate in – whether it’s traditional brushwork and airbrushing, pylon and sky signs, retail fit out or wayfaring signage, sculptural and fabricated projects, routing and engraving, illuminated and neon signs, or digital LED and LCD screens, there will be a category that suits you,” he said.

The winners of the competition will be recognised at the ASGA 2026 National Sign & Graphics Awards Gala Presentation Dinner, to be held on Thursday, 3 September in Hall 2A at the Sydney Showground, Sydney Olympic Park.

“This event will be the crowning highlight of a week where the focus of the industry will be on Sydney, with the Visual Impact Conference & Expo running from Wednesday 2 – Friday 4 September at the Showground,” Harrold says.

“In the mornings during the show, this venue will be home to the Conference, but on Thursday evening it will be transformed into a sparkling ballroom for the gala awards ceremony, providing the perfect venue for us to celebrate excellence over a gourmet three-course dinner, music and entertainment.

“This really is the industry’s ‘Night of Nights’, so I’d urge everyone to mark the date in your diary now, and watch for tickets which will be on sale from June 2026,” concludes Harrold.
